Wenzhou Bee Automobile Parts Co., Ltd.

Oxygen Sensor 234-4810 24132 250-24685 75-3674 19060381 2344810 15121 AP4-630 213-3954 5S9257

  • USD $7 - $33 / Piece
  • 100 Piece / Pieces